DEVICE COOPERATION SERVICE EXECUTION APPARATUS, DEVICE COOPERATION SERVICE EXECUTION METHOD, COMPUTER-READABLE RECORDING MEDIUM
First Claim
1. A device cooperation service execution apparatus that executes a device cooperation service while cooperating with a device connected to a local network, comprising:
- a device retrieval unit that retrieves devices connected to the local network;
a device information management unit that records device information relating to the devices retrieved by the device retrieval unit in a local storage;
an application information acquisition unit that obtains device cooperation service list information indicating device cooperation services that can be executed by an unconnected device, which is a device whose device information is recorded in the local storage but which was not retrieved by the device retrieval unit, and a connected device, which is a device retrieved by the device retrieval unit;
a service list display unit that displays a list of the device cooperation services indicated by the device cooperation service list information and a list of the unconnected devices and the connected devices; and
a service execution unit that executes a device cooperation service selected by a user from the list of device cooperation services displayed by the service list display unit by launching an application for executing the device cooperation service,wherein the device cooperation service list information includes device information of devices required to execute the respective device cooperation services, andthe service list display unit determines on the basis of the device cooperation service list information and the device list of the unconnected devices and the connected devices whether or not the unconnected device is included in the devices required to execute the respective device cooperation services, and when the unconnected device is included, notifies the user that a device cooperation service requiring the unconnected device cannot be selected.
2 Assignments
0 Petitions
Accused Products
Abstract
An application information acquisition unit 405 transmits a device list of unconnected devices, which are owned devices recorded in a local storage 407 but not retrieved by a device retrieval unit 402, and connected devices, which are owned devices retrieved by the device retrieval unit 402, to an external server 107 via an external network. A service list display unit 406 displays a list of device cooperation services indicated in device cooperation service list information obtained by the application information acquisition unit 405 from the external server 107 and a list of devices determined to be owned devices by an owned device management unit 404 on a display unit 410, whereby a user is prompted to select a device cooperation service.
32 Citations
11 Claims
-
1. A device cooperation service execution apparatus that executes a device cooperation service while cooperating with a device connected to a local network, comprising:
-
a device retrieval unit that retrieves devices connected to the local network; a device information management unit that records device information relating to the devices retrieved by the device retrieval unit in a local storage; an application information acquisition unit that obtains device cooperation service list information indicating device cooperation services that can be executed by an unconnected device, which is a device whose device information is recorded in the local storage but which was not retrieved by the device retrieval unit, and a connected device, which is a device retrieved by the device retrieval unit; a service list display unit that displays a list of the device cooperation services indicated by the device cooperation service list information and a list of the unconnected devices and the connected devices; and a service execution unit that executes a device cooperation service selected by a user from the list of device cooperation services displayed by the service list display unit by launching an application for executing the device cooperation service, wherein the device cooperation service list information includes device information of devices required to execute the respective device cooperation services, and the service list display unit determines on the basis of the device cooperation service list information and the device list of the unconnected devices and the connected devices whether or not the unconnected device is included in the devices required to execute the respective device cooperation services, and when the unconnected device is included, notifies the user that a device cooperation service requiring the unconnected device cannot be selected.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A device cooperation service execution method using a device cooperation service execution apparatus that executes a device cooperation service while cooperating with a device connected to a local network, the method comprising:
-
a device retrieval step in which the device cooperation service execution apparatus retrieves devices connected to the local network; a device information management step in which the device cooperation service execution apparatus records device information relating to the devices retrieved in the device retrieval step in a local storage; an application information acquisition step in which the device cooperation service execution apparatus obtains device cooperation service list information indicating device cooperation services that can be executed by an unconnected device, which is a device whose device information is recorded in the local storage but which was not retrieved in the device retrieval step, and a connected device, which is a device retrieved in the device retrieval step; a service list display step in which the device cooperation service execution apparatus displays a list of the device cooperation services indicated by the device cooperation service list information and a list of the unconnected devices and the connected devices; and a service execution step in which the device cooperation service execution apparatus executes a device cooperation service selected by a user from the list of device cooperation services displayed in the service list display step by launching an application for executing the device cooperation service, wherein the device cooperation service list information includes device information of devices required to execute the respective device cooperation services, and in the service list display step, a determination is made on the basis of the device cooperation service list information and the device list of the unconnected devices and the connected devices as to whether or not the unconnected device is included in the devices required to execute the respective device cooperation services, and when the unconnected device is included, the user is notified that a device cooperation service requiring the unconnected device cannot be selected.
-
-
11. A computer-readable recording medium which stores a device cooperation service execution program for executing a device cooperation service while cooperating with a device connected to a local network, the program causing a computer to function as:
-
a device retrieval unit that retrieves devices connected to the local network; a device information management unit that records device information relating to the devices retrieved by the device retrieval unit in a local storage; an application information acquisition unit that obtains device cooperation service list information indicating device cooperation services that can be executed by an unconnected device, which is a device whose device information is recorded in the local storage but which was not retrieved by the device retrieval unit, and a connected device, which is a device retrieved by the device retrieval unit; a service list display unit that displays a list of the device cooperation services indicated by the device cooperation service list information and a list of the unconnected devices and the connected devices; and a service execution unit that executes a device cooperation service selected by a user from the list of device cooperation services displayed by the service list display unit by launching an application for executing the device cooperation service, wherein the device cooperation service list information includes device information of devices required to execute the respective device cooperation services, and the service list display unit determines on the basis of the device cooperation service list information and the device list of the unconnected devices and the connected devices whether or not the unconnected device is included in the devices required to execute the respective device cooperation services, and when the unconnected device is included, notifies the user that a device cooperation service requiring the unconnected device cannot be selected.
-
Specification